Two days ago it was confirmed that Supreme Leader Ali Khamenei had been killed following attacks across Iran by Israel and the US.

According to reports, Ali Khamenei was holding a secret meeting with his close advisors at his palace in Iran.

Although the meeting was confidential, someone allegedly passed the information to Israel's intelligence agency, Mossad.

Mossad operatives reportedly received details from inside the Iranian government about where Khamenei would hold the meeting, when, and who would be present.

Experts are of the opinion that such attacks are usually carried out at night, but after receiving the information, Israel allegedly decided to launch an immediate attack in the morning.

Israel had initially planned to launch the attack at night, but acted quickly after receiving specific information regarding the Supreme Leader's location.

Who betrayed Supreme Leader Ali Khamenei?

According to reports, the Israeli intelligence agency Mossad had provided details about the Supreme Leader's confidential meetings. Mossad operatives reportedly learned that Iran's top leadership was scheduled to attend a meeting inside the presidential palace at 9 a.m. local time on Saturday.

The Israelis had precise information about when the meeting was starting, what it was about, who was present, where everyone was sitting, and which room Khamenei was sitting in. An indication of how deeply the Israeli secret service Mossad has eroded the Iranian state was that the information came from a person with absolute confidence in Khamenei, who was, literally, at his side.

The information was so “inside” that the agent recruited by Mossad first informed Benjamin Netanyahu himself, sending a video on his cellphone of the discovery of Khamenei’s body (showing the characteristic ring on his hand) and then a clear photo of the face of the dead supreme leader of Iran.

Is the agent a general?

It is considered certain that the image of the dead Khamenei was not sent to Netanyahu by an Israeli drone, but by an agent recruited by Mossad. Who was it? Rumors abound, based not on information, but on repeated coincidences, which indicate that it could be the Revolutionary Guard general and commander of the “Quds Force”, Ismail Qaani.

Ismail Qaani

He is the one who succeeded Soleimani after his death and enjoyed the absolute trust of Khamenei. Of course, since the Iranian general was appointed, he has been accidentally spared from Mossad operations.

He did so even on the day he, as an Iranian envoy, was giving Hezbollah the knowledge to confront the IDF. Of course, on the day someone made a handshake that laced Hezbollah leader Hassan Nasrallah’s hand with a substance and turned it into a “transmitter,” he was spared. Instead, Nasrallah was killed, as was his successor at the helm of Hezbollah, Safieddine, in a deadly precision strike by the Israelis. Qaani was presumed dead for days, reportedly escaping “by a narrow margin.”

Qaani was reportedly considered a suspect in Tehran and was questioned, which ended when the general collapsed and was taken to hospital with symptoms of a heart attack.

After Qaani purged his opponents in the Revolutionary Guards, he became a topic of discussion again. It is said that in July 2024 he visited Ismail Haniyeh, at a top-secret location in central Tehran. Shortly afterwards, the Israelis blew up Haniyeh's hideout. Qaani escaped "for a short time."

Again “by chance” he reportedly survived Israeli attacks during the 12-day war, during which much of Iran’s military leadership was killed. And now, he was missing, or had just left Khamenei’s office, when the Israelis struck with 30 precision bombs, killing them all. Logically, the person who would dare to take out his cell phone and take a picture of the supreme leader’s body, amidst the rubble, could only be a senior Iranian military official.
